High Forest Fire Risk in Southern Sweden This Week

The coming days pose a great, very great – and locally extremely great – risk for forest and land fires in extensive areas in southern Sweden, according to SMHI.

According to the weather authority, the risk assessment applies on Wednesday, Thursday and Friday for parts of eastern and northern Götaland as well as parts of Skåne and eastern Svealand.

Primarily on Öland – as well as locally in Skåne and northern Götaland – the risk is considered extremely high.

People are asked to consider that hazardous fires can easily occur due to, for example, burning, sparks from machines or lightning strikes.

A piece of advice is to check if a burning ban applies in your current area, and to be very cautious.

Additionally, the weather in the areas will be warm in the near future and then the fire spreads easily in forests and land, and can, among other things, cause disruptions in the power and telephone network when they ravage cable routes.

There is also a locally high risk of fires in forests and land in parts of northern Västerbotten, but that risk ceases at 23.00 on Wednesday.

SMHI has also flagged high daytime temperatures in southern and southeastern Götaland. From Wednesday and until Friday, temperatures above 26 degrees and up to 30 degrees locally are expected in large parts of Skåne, Blekinge and Småland.
